Shockwave Therapy

Supporting Recovery and Tissue Health With Shockwave Therapy

People exploring shockwave therapy in Pitt Meadows, BC often feel stuck with pain or stiffness that has not fully improved with rest alone. Discomfort may affect walking, lifting, working, or staying active. Some people notice symptoms that return as soon as activity increases, while others feel restricted by long-standing tightness or sensitivity in specific areas. Many are looking for an option that supports tissue recovery and helps movement feel easier again.

Shockwave therapy uses targeted sound waves delivered to specific tissues. These waves stimulate a local response that can support healing and improve how tissues tolerate load. At MeadowLife Physiotherapy and Active Rehab Center, shockwave therapy is used as part of a broader physiotherapy plan focused on restoring movement, strength, and long-term function.

When Shockwave Therapy May Be Included in Care

Therapists at MeadowLife Physiotherapy and Active Rehab Center may recommend shockwave therapy when pain or stiffness limits progress with movement-based rehabilitation. Shockwave therapy is not a standalone solution. It supports recovery when combined with exercise, movement retraining, and education.

Shockwave therapy may be helpful when people experience:

  • Ongoing tendon discomfort
  • Stiffness that limits daily movement
  • Pain with loading or repeated activity
  • Reduced tolerance for exercise
  • Symptoms that linger after injury
  • Difficulty progressing strengthening programs

Use always depends on individual assessment and response to care.

How Shockwave Therapy at MeadowLife Physiotherapy and Active Rehab Center Supports Your Recovery

Shockwave therapy at MeadowLife Physiotherapy and Active Rehab Center works best as part of a full physiotherapy plan that includes exercise, movement training, and education. Therapists determine whether shockwave therapy is appropriate based on assessment findings and functional goals.

Approaches may include:

  • Targeted shockwave application, which focuses on affected tendons or tissues to support healing response and improve load tolerance
  • Gradual exposure planning, which helps tissues adapt more comfortably to movement and activity
  • Integration with strengthening programs, which supports lasting improvements rather than temporary change
  • Movement-specific guidance, which helps patients apply gains to daily tasks or sport
  • Monitoring tissue response, which ensures treatment intensity and frequency match individual tolerance
  • Education on activity modification, which supports recovery while staying active

Shockwave therapy supports tissue adaptation while physiotherapy builds strength and movement confidence.
